Royal Highlands, located between Weeki Wachee Springs State Park and the Gulf Coast, is a low-density and nature-forward North Weeki Wachee neighborhood with large lots and a pine-and-palmetto landscape. The neighborhood’s character concentrates along US-19 near the Cortez Boulevard junction, where bait shops, produce stands, and local diners set a practical, outdoorsy tone. Homes skew toward ranch-style and Florida contemporary builds, often with room for boats, RVs, and workshops. The Weeki Wachee River and nearby springs shape weekends around paddling, fishing, and wildlife watching. Weeki Wachee Springs State Park and Buccaneer Bay Waterpark act as signature local anchors. SunWest Park adds a freshwater beach and trail network for a change of scenery.
